SECTION 1 - M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ES To support the Receptionists/Clerks in ensuring all operational processes are adhered to in accordance with Trust policies and Standard Operating Procedures. To provide advice, guidance and support to the Receptionists/Clerks on day to day issues that may arise within the service. Provide day to day coordination of staff including allocation of work. With the support of the A&E Admin Supervisor, plan and circulate the weekly / monthly rota for all Receptionists/Clerks to ensure there is adequate staffing on a daily basis.

To have an awareness of communication difficulties i.e. language, hearing and sight impaired service users and to be able to communicate sensitively and effectively. To have the ability to handle occasional aggressive patients. To communicate effectively and maintain good relationships with service users / patients, medical professionals and other departments across the health and social care setting and other outside agencies.

Responsibility for Service User / Patient Care To ensure service users are given appropriate information and direction in relation to the services provided. To ensure service users are greeted and dealt with in a courteous and professional manner. To identify and take action on any problems, bringing them to the attention of the A&E Admin Supervisor, where these issues cannot be dealt with at A&E Admin Team Leader level. Planning and Organising With support from the A&E Admin Supervisor, ensure that A&E & Same Day Emergency Care areas are adequately resourced in terms of staffing levels to maintain a 7-day week service, ensuring that all shifts are fully covered.

Organise and plan own day to day workload or activities as well as the workload or activities for the Receptionists / Clerks in order to meet the demands of the service. Management of own workload as delegated by A&E Supervisor/Assistant Directorate Manager. To provide mentoring and training for all new and current staff in relation to systems and processes. To assist with the planning and organising of mandatory training for all staff within the required timeframes.

To use the appropriate systems to manage patient attendances and appointments. To assist with data collection and audit as requested by the A&E Admin Supervisor/Assistant Directorate Manager. To oversee the inputting of data and ensure adherence is given by Receptionists / Clerks. To promote and monitor the quality of work within the service in order to provide an optimum service.

Due to the nature of the work, the post holder must be able to prioritise, as frequent interruptions can be expected from the public and professionals. The post holder is expected to use their initiative to a significant level and work without direct supervision. Responsibilities for Physical and / or Financial Resources Ensure safe and efficient use of equipment, resources and consumables at all times. Responsible for ordering stock items (stationary) for the A&E Admin department.

Responsibility for Policy and Service Development and Implementation To contribute to the review and development of policies as appropriate to the service. To identify areas that could be enhanced to support service development. Highlight and implement changes to working practice which would improve the day to day operational functions within A&E / Same Day Emergency Care Adhere to Policies and Procedures. Responsibilities for Human Resources and Leadership To ensure staff are aware and adhere to all Trust policies and procedures.

To contribute to the recruitment and selection process of Clerks according to Trust procedures. Responsible for the supervision of staff incorporating 1:1s and authorising annual leave. To participate in appraisal process with the A&E Admin Supervisor. Using your knowledge and skills, provide support and guidance to staff as required.

Take and transcribe minutes of meetings as required. Research, Development and Audit To provide assistance as requested by the A&E Admin Supervisor to complete internal clerical audits.
